    I would absolutely love to see Montes in a Rapids kit. Montes has that short stocky build that ride tackles and plays with a little fiery edge. Though he does rack up his fair share of yellows. His passing and first touch has always been top notch and has a canon from distance. I am not sure Montes necessarily fits the Rapids "style" but we have no real style so maybe he could give us a base. He kinda sorta reminds me of a Javi Morales with a Dax McCarty feistiness to him.


    Montes has been fine since his leg break and has showed really no signs of it effecting his career. He has pretty much been the model of consistency. Montes really only missed the 2014 Apetura after the leg break and retained his spot almost immediately. He has started 73 of 84 matches in Liga MX since the break including all but one league match this league. At 31, age is of real no concern. Plenty left in the tank.

    At the rumored $3M.......now that is a little hefty but there is no question Montes is DP material and would be a HUGE upgrade. I heard things here and there that Montes name could put a few more butts in the stands and this is a marketing signing. I doubt that. He is clearly well known in MX, clearly an outstanding player, but has been an off-and-on MX international. Montes big name but not a "Mexican star" - if you will.

    His numbers don't wow you on paper that is for sure. I was a little shocked when I looked them up. Admittedly, I have just seen a few Leon matches here and there over the past year. Again, admittedly it was when William Yarbrough was called up to the US and I wanted to see him out of curiosity. But with that said.......Montes was no doubt integral to their attack. The ball flowed through him. The end product -- i.e. assist -- did not necessarily came off his foot. Many times we was slinging the ball sideline to sideline to putting Elias Hernandez in position to whip the ball into the ever dangerous Mauro Boselli. "Hockey" assist champion ----- I don't know but he looked dangerous and looked active in those handful of matches. Numbers can be deceiving. As we know they don't always tell the whole story. He shared a butt load of the playmaking with Elias Hernandez. That could be some of it. I am not sure. I did like what I saw. Montes stood out.
